Power  management 
To  reduce  power  consumption,  the  computer  has  three 
power  management  modes:  screen  blank,  standby,  and 
hibernation. 
 
 
Notes 
v  Screen  blank  mode  is  called  standby  mode  in 
Windows  95  and  Windows  NT. 
v  Standby  mode  is  called  suspend  mode  in 
Windows  95  and  Windows  NT.
Screen  blank  mode 
Screen  blank  mode  has  three  variants,  as  follows: 
1.  If  you  press  Fn+F3,  or  the  time  set  on  the  “LCD  off 
timer”  in  IBM  BIOS  Setup  Utility  expires, 
v  The  LCD  backlight  turns  off. 
v  The  hard  disk  drive  motor  stops. 
v  The  speaker  is  muted.
